- Summary:
- This book constitutes the refereed proceedings of the 9th International Symposium on End-User Development, IS-EUD 2023, held in Cagliari, Italy, during June 6–8, 2023. The 17 full papers and 2 (keynote extended abstracts) included in this book were carefully reviewed and selected from 26 submissions. They were organized in topical sections as follows: Artificial Intelligence for End-Users; Internet of Things for End-Users; Privacy; Security and Society; Supporting End-User Development.
